| dc.description.abstract | The transformation towards a circular economy has become a crucial step in reducing plastic waste generation. PT Majestic Buana Group had the opportunity to increase its business value by developing a circular business model through a final product derived from plastic waste. This study aimed to analyze the existing business model of PT MBG using the Business Model Canvas approach, identify ongoing circular activities, and design a new business model based on the Circular Business Model Canvas.The research method was descriptive qualitative, with data collected through in-depth interviews with three PT MBG managers, field observations, and literature study. This research was conducted from August 2024 to July 2025. The results showed that PT MBG's existing business model still focused on recycling activities and the sale of plastic shredding machines. A key finding of this study was the design of a new CBMC that transformed PT MBG's business model from merely selling raw plastic shreds to producing circular paving block products. The implementation of the new business model was further elaborated through an activity timeline and the division of managerial roles. | - |
